Step resurfacing services involve restoring the surface of concrete or stone surfaces by removing a thin layer of the existing material. This process typically uses specialized equipment to grind, polish, or chemically treat the surface, resulting in a smoother, more uniform appearance. The goal is to eliminate surface imperfections, such as pitting, discoloration, or minor cracks, while enhancing the overall look and durability of the surface. Property owners often choose this service to improve the aesthetic appeal of their outdoor spaces or to prepare surfaces for additional finishes or coatings.

This service is particularly effective in addressing common problems like surface wear, staining, and minor damage that can accumulate over time. For example, concrete driveways or patios may develop rough patches, discoloration from weather exposure, or surface cracks that detract from their appearance. Step resurfacing can help mitigate these issues by providing a fresh, even surface that looks cleaner and more appealing. It also offers a way to extend the lifespan of existing surfaces without the need for complete replacement, making it a practical solution for property owners looking to maintain or upgrade their outdoor areas.

The overview below groups typical Step Resurfacing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Boston,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or step resurfacing projects us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and condition of the steps.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Mid-Size Projects - larger or more detailed resurfacing jobs often cost between $600-$1,200. These projects may involve multiple steps or more extensive surface preparation, which can increase the overall cost. Local contractors generally handle these projects regularly within this range.

Large or Complex Jobs - extensive resurfacing work, such as on multiple entries or with custom finishes, can reach $1,200-$3,000. Such projects are less common but are handled by experienced local pros for clients seeking durable, high-quality results.

Full Replacement - in cases where resurfacing isn't feasible, full step replacement can start around $3,000 and go higher depending on size and materials. Larger, more intricate projects can exceed $5,000, though these are less frequent and typically involve significant structural work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can Step Resurfacing services improve? Step Resurfacing services typically target concrete, stone, or tile steps to restore their appearance and durability.

How do local contractors prepare for Step Resurfacing projects? Contractors usually clean and repair existing surfaces before applying resurfacing materials to ensure a smooth and long-lasting finish.

Are there different styles or finishes available for resurfaced steps? Yes, local service providers often offer various textures, colors, and finishes to match the property's aesthetic preferences.

What are common issues that Step Resurfacing can address? Resurfacing can help fix cracks, chips, discoloration, and uneven surfaces on outdoor or indoor steps.

How do local contractors ensure the durability of resurfaced steps? They typically use high-quality materials and proper surface preparation techniques to enhance the longevity of the resurfacing work.
